Why Choose Miami for Your Retreat
Miami is not only known for its beautiful beaches but also for its diverse array of venues that cater to corporate groups. The best times to visit are from December to April when the weather is perfect, and rates are generally more favorable. However, be cautious as hotel prices can spike during major events like Art Basel in December. Miami International Airport (MIA) is easily accessible, making travel logistics a breeze.

Budget Breakdown
To maximize your $10K budget for a 20-person retreat, consider the following breakdown:
- Venue Costs: $4,500 (average of $225/person for 20 people)
- Food & Beverage: $2,500 (average of $125/person)
- Activities: $1,500 (team-building activities)
- Travel Costs: $1,500 (average flight and local transport)
- Contingency: $1,000 (unexpected expenses)
Planning Timeline
8-12 Weeks Before Your Retreat
- Week 12: Define team goals and objectives for the retreat.
- Week 11: Research and shortlist venues (use the table above).
- Week 10: Schedule venue tours; finalize venue.
- Week 9: Book the venue and confirm dates.
- Week 8: Arrange food and beverage options with venue.
- Week 7: Plan team-building activities; book vendors.
- Week 6: Arrange travel logistics; book flights for attendees.
- Week 5: Finalize the agenda and share with attendees.
- Week 4: Confirm all vendor arrangements and timelines.
- Week 3: Prepare welcome packets for attendees.
- Week 2: Conduct a final check-in with all vendors.
- Week 1: Execute the retreat and enjoy!
Risk Mitigation
Identify potential risks such as weather disruptions or last-minute cancellations. Have a backup plan for outdoor activities, and ensure that you confirm all bookings one week prior to the retreat.
